Three people have been killed and five injured when an explosion struck a mosque in Syria’s Homs, according to Syrian state media reports.
The attack targeted the Imam Ali bin Abi Talib Mosque in the Wadi al-Dahab neighbourhood of Homs shortly after Friday prayers, the Syrian Arab News Agency (SANA) reported.
State media said security forces had imposed a cordon around the area and were investigating.
Local officials told Reuters news agency it may have been caused by a suicide bomber or explosives placed there.
